RESUMO

Background: This study aimed to investigate the feasibility of preoperative identification of sentinel lymph nodes (SLNs) by contrast-enhanced ultrasound (CEUS) for patients with breast cancer. Methods: The patients with T1-T2N0M0 breast cancer who were scheduled for primary surgical treatment were recruited. All the patients had received a periareolar intradermal injection of an ultrasonic contrast agent (SonoVue, Bracco, Milan, Italy) followed by an ultrasound to identify contrast-enhanced SLNs. A guidewire was deployed to localize the SLN. Methylene blue stain was used to help trace SLNs during the operation. The identification rate and accuracy rate were recorded. The number of SLNs labeled by two methods was counted and compared using Wilcoxon testing. Results: A total of 366 SLNs were detected in 72 patients by methylene blue intraoperatively, with a median of 5 lymph nodes [interquartile range (IQR), 4-6] per patient. A total of 95 SLNs were detected in 63 patients (87.5%) by CEUS, with a median of 1 lymph node (IQR, 1-2) per patient. The number of SLNs detected by CEUS was significantly less than that labeled by the methylene blue staining method (Z=-7.362, P=0000). Pathology confirmed 12 single metastases in all the lymph nodes examined, 10 of which were the only lymph node identified by CEUS. Conclusions: Periareolar intradermal injection of an ultrasonic contrast agent was an effective and convenient supplementary to localize SLNs. The technique was expected to improve the accuracy of axillary staging with minor surgical trauma and postoperative complications.

RESUMO

The present study aimed at evaluating and comparing the diagnostic performance of B-mode ultrasound (US), elastography score (ES), and strain ratio (SR) for the differentiation of breast lesions. This retrospective study enrolled 431 lesions from 417 in-hospital patients. All patients were examined with both conventional ultrasound and elastography. Two experienced radiologists reviewed ultrasound and elasticity images. The histopathologic result obtained from ultrasound-guided core biopsy or operation excisions were used as the reference standard. Pathologic examination revealed 276 malignant lesions (64%) and 155 benign lesions (36%). A cut-off point of 4.15 (area under the curve, 0.891) allowed significant differentiation of malignant and benign lesions. ROC (receiver-operating characteristic) curves showed a higher value for combination of B-mode ultrasound and elastography for the diagnosis of breast lesions. RESUMO

BACKGROUND: As an uncommon presentation, occult primary breast cancer remains a diagnostic and therapeutic challenge in clinical practice. This study aimed to retrospectively assess the feasibility of breast magnetic resonance imaging (MRI) in patients with malignant axillary lymphadenopathy and unknown primary malignancy, and correlation with histopathological characteristics. METHODS: A total of 35 women with occult breast carcinoma were evaluated with dynamic contrast-enhanced breast MRI. Whole seriate section was used in all cases. MRI performance was assessed and correlated with histopathological findings. RESULTS: Twenty-one of 35 patients were found to have primary breast carcinoma histologically. Twenty of the 21 patients had abnormal MR findings and 1 patient had a normal MRI study. Of the remaining 14 patients, 10 were negative on both MRI and surgery. Four had suspicious enhancement on MRI and no corresponding tumor was found. Lesions with mass enhancement were found in 55% (11/20) and ductual and segmental enhancement in 45%. The average diameter of the primary tumors was 15 mm. Invasive ductal carcinomas were found in 81% (17/21). One of 17 invasive ductual carcinomas was too small to be graded. Fourteen of the remaining 16 were classified as grade II and 2 as grade I. Thirty-two of the 35 patients had received estrogen receptor, progesterone receptor and human epidermal growth factor receptor 2 examinations and the 12 of 32 were triple-negative breast carcinoma. CONCLUSIONS: Mass lesions with small size and lesions with ductal or segment enhancement are common MRI features in patients with occult breast cancer. The dominant types of primary tumors are invasive ductal carcinoma with moderate histopathological grade. The rate of triple-negative breast carcinoma may be higher in occult breast cancer.
